macos - OSX 协同设计。避免检查特定资源

标签 macos resources codesign

在 OSX 中,我有一个资源文件,其中包含可执行文件的校验和。

协同设计会改变可执行文件,因此如果我在协同设计后计算校验和,我需要存储结果的文件不被检查(它位于资源中)。

有办法实现这一点吗?,另一个选项是在执行时以编程方式验证编码,但这看起来更复杂......

最佳答案

我找到了这个

https://developer.apple.com/library/mac/technotes/tn2206/_index.html#//apple_ref/doc/uid/DTS40007919-CH1-TNTAG206

根据本技术说明,不幸的是,不再可能从协同设计中排除资源。

关于macos - OSX 协同设计。避免检查特定资源,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27903609/

相关文章:

Java 1.8.0_251,OSX Catalina,屏幕外窗口的字体渲染损坏

android - Android中是否可以有多个字符串资源文件?

ios - Crashlytics - 不允许协同设计用户交互

ios - iOS 应用程序的 Jenkins 代码签名失败

macos - 如何从命令行构建 Safari 扩展包?

xcode - 如何 CFRelease 必须返回的 CGEventRef?

ruby-on-rails - 运行 '__rvm_make install' 时出错,

macos - 如何使 libcurl 在 Mac 钥匙串(keychain)中查找证书

python - 对未知代码设置限制的最佳方法是什么?

Laravel 路线 : 路线::资源